TMC’s Abhishek claims ‘BJP-backed miscreants’ set ablaze 10 shops in Khejuri; BJP denies charge

Trinamool Congress (TMC) leader Abhishek Banerjee on Monday (May 11, 2026) alleged that “BJP-backed miscreants” set nearly 10 shops ablaze in Purba Medinipur’s Khejuri in front of police personnel and accused Union Home Minister Amit Shah of promoting “targeted violence” in West Bengal.

Rejecting the allegations, a BJP leader in Purba Medinipur said the party always espouses peace.

This came a day after the TMC National General Secretary made a similar allegation while claiming that 60 shops were set on fire in the same place.

Earlier on Monday (May 11, 2026), Mr. Banerjee shared on X a clip of a raging fire to claim that “nearly 10 shops were allegedly set ablaze last night by BJP miscreants” in the Jonka gram panchyayat area of Khejuri, “right in front of police”.

Bengal is already witnessing a DOUBLE ENGINE DISASTER.

In Khejuri’s Jonka GP, West Bhangan Mari area, nearly 10 shops were allegedly set ablaze last night by BJP miscreants, right in front of the police. Entire livelihoods have been reduced to ashes because hatred and… pic.twitter.com/qa1ioEl700

— Abhishek Banerjee (@abhishekaitc) May 11, 2026

A senior police official said five shops were set ablaze by unidentified people at Khejuri late on Sunday (May 10, 2026) night.

Quoting eyewitnesses, the official said bike-borne unidentified miscreants set the shops ablaze in the Bhanganmari Kolmor area of Khejuri and two fire engines were rushed to the spot. Rapid Action Force (RAF) personnel and central forces have been deployed in the area, he said.

Mr. Banerjee continued his tirade against the BJP, terming the incident “a double-engine disaster”. He alleged people’s “livelihoods have been reduced to ashes because hatred and intimidation are now being used as political tools”.

“This was the true face of the politics preached by (Union Home Minister) Amit Shah and the BJP,” the TMC leader said and alleged that “targeted violence was being carried out with complete impunity”.

Questioning the role of the central forces, he asked, “Where are the central forces now? Or are they deployed only when it suits the BJP’s political agenda?”

However, the BJP leader in Purba Medinipur claimed that some people, “instigated by the TMC”, are trying to cause unrest in the area using the BJP’s name.

“Police are investigating the matter, and we are also keeping a watch. Strict action should be taken against those involved,” he said.
